Image by Protein synthesis.svg Unraveling Transcription and Translation Proteins are the building blocks of life, playing critical roles in various biological processes such as cell structure, function, and regulation. The intricate process of protein synthesis involves two main stages: transcription and translation. These processes occur within the cellular machinery, orchestrated by specific enzymes and molecules, and are essential for the creation of functional proteins. Transcription: From DNA to mRNA The journey of protein synthesis begins in the nucleus of eukaryotic cells, where the genetic information is stored in the form of DNA.
